Output e708737d2cce5801218d6fd9cbcd178b41420d6895bd460e229aeaa6d99fbd9f:1

value
25826213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270b3f24b7378b6475aa69e4997e4e9b0d045714 OP_EQUAL
address
35FTkTRShNaQ21N613FvdncdQKRjJa8C2P
transaction
e708737d2cce5801218d6fd9cbcd178b41420d6895bd460e229aeaa6d99fbd9f
spent
true